1 When Ephraim spoke, they were feared, for they were the leading tribe in Israel. But when they were guilty of Baal worship, they died.
When the words of my law came from Ephraim, he was lifted up in Israel; but when he did evil through the Baal, death overtook him.
2 Now they constantly sin, making for themselves idols from molten metal. All of these idols are skillfully made from silver by their craftsmen. “Offer sacrifices to these idols,” say the people. “Kiss the bull calf idols.”
And now their sins are increased; they have made themselves a metal image, false gods from their silver, after their designs, all of them the work of the metal-workers; they say of them, Let them give offerings, let men give kisses to the oxen.
3 Consequently they will be like the morning mist, like early morning dew, like chaff blowing away from the threshing floor, like smoke from a chimney.
So they will be like the morning cloud, like the dew which goes early away, like the dust of the grain which the wind is driving out of the crushing-floor, like smoke going up from the fireplace.
4 Yet I am the Lord your God who brought you out of the land of Egypt. You shall know no other gods but me. None can save you except me.
But I am the Lord your God, from the land of Egypt; you have knowledge of no other God and there is no saviour but me.
5 I looked after you in the wilderness; in that dry desert land it was like pasture to them
I had knowledge of you in the waste land where no water was.
6 and they were satisfied. But when they were satisfied they became arrogant, and they forgot me.
When I gave them food they were full, and their hearts were full of pride, and they did not keep me in mind.
7 So I will be like a lion to them, like a leopard I will lie in wait beside the path.
So I will be like a lion to them; as a cruel beast I will keep watch by the road;
8 I will be like a mother bear whose cubs have been taken, I will rip out their hearts. I shall devour them like a lion, like a wild beast I will tear them apart.
I will come face to face with them like a bear whose young ones have been taken from her, and their inmost hearts will be broken; there the dogs will make a meal of them; they will be wounded by the beasts of the field.
9 You have destroyed yourselves, Israel, for your only help is in me.
I have sent destruction on you, O Israel; who will be your helper?
10 Where then is your king? Let him save you in all your cities! Where are your leaders who demanded a king and princes from me?
Where is your king, that he may be your saviour? and all your rulers, that they may take up your cause? of whom you said, Give me a king and rulers.
11 In my anger I give you a king, and in my fury I take one.
I have given you a king, because I was angry, and have taken him away in my wrath.
12 Ephraim's guilt is packed up; their sin will be eradicated.
The wrongdoing of Ephraim is shut up; his sin is put away in secret.
13 The pain of childbirth has come to them, trying to give birth to a son who is not “wise” because he is not in the right position when the time comes.
The pains of a woman in childbirth will come on him: he is an unwise son, for at this time it is not right for him to keep his place when children come to birth.
14 I shall redeem them from the power of Sheol; I shall deliver them from death. Where, death, are your plagues? Where, Sheol, is your destruction? Compassion is hidden from my sight. (Sheol h7585)
I will give the price to make them free from the power of the underworld, I will be their saviour from death: O death! where are your pains? O underworld! where is your destruction? my eyes will have no pity. (Sheol h7585)
15 Even though they flourish among the reeds, an east wind will come, a wind from the Lord that rises in the desert will dry up their springs and their wells will fail. It will rob from their treasury everything of value.
Though he gives fruit among his brothers, an east wind will come, the wind of the Lord coming up from the waste land, and his spring will become dry, his fountain will be without water: it will make waste the store of all the vessels of his desire.
16 Samaria will have to bear the consequences of their guilt, because they rebelled against her God. They will be slaughtered by the sword; their children will be dashed to the ground; their pregnant women will be ripped open.
Samaria will be made waste, for she has gone against her God: they will be cut down by the sword, their little children will be broken on the rocks, their women who are with child will be cut open.
